iOS data recovery with Disk Drill. Step by step CleverFiles Hello ladies and gentleman, Adrian here from the Disk Drill team. Today we-re going to be taking a look at this iOS data recovery feature within Disk Drill: https://www.cleverfiles.com/iphone-data-recovery.html Within Disk Drill 3.2 specifically we introduced an all new iOS recovery module, making it easier than ever to get your data off your iOS device. Be-it an iPhone, iPod, or iPad. It-s as simple as plugging in your device here. And the way the iOS recovery module work is if you hit recover here. It-s going to be based off your previous iTunes backups. So, if you-ve recovered data in the past or you-ve backed up in the past to your iTunes. Then you-re allowed to go ahead and manually sort through those backups and get the files as needed. So, you can see here once I-ve plugged in my device it automatically detected my most recent backup. It shows it has one backup found on this computer. I can simply click on Recover. It-s going to go ahead and reconstruct those files based off the iTunes backup. I manually have the option now to recover data from that specific backup which is very, very useful. Lets say you just want a photo that used to be on your phone that you accidentally deleted or a video or a text message. Or maybe you needed a contact that accidentally got deleted. You can manually comb through all the data with our new iOS recovery module. You-ll see here under the all data tab it tells you how many files Disk Drill has found. In this case about 19,000. That-s about 33GB of data found. You can see here it also shows you how many other files it found outside of the main categories. There-s contacts, calendars, bookmarks, notes, application photos, regular photos, video, call history, and text messages. Keeping in mind on the left hand pane here you can easily jump to these categories. For example I could jump to photos, I can jump to videos, bookmarks, or text notes as needed. Really simple, really easy here. Now, if you want to select a whole category, lets say you already know you want all the photos backed up. You simply just click on the checkbox here and then you-ve selected all of those photos to be recovered. Otherwise you can go ahead and manually select the things you want to recovered, for example I want to go in here. I-ll say I want to select this photo right here that I want to recover. Maybe I want the bookmarks and the text notes. I want all of those recovered. Now when it comes to recovery there-s a couple of ways you can do it. First off you can recover to a specific location, in the top right. You can see I-ve defined my desktop as a folder I want to recover the files to, or you can go to the bottom left here and mount the found items as a disk. What this does is it quite literally mounts it as a disk, as if you plugged in a USB drive or what-have- you. And this makes it really easy for you to go ahead and move files around as needed. So if I do that you can see here it makes all of these backups here as a disk that I can easily comb through within each folder. I can go into the bookmarks folder, take the html file out, move it around as needed weather that-s localy to the computer or to another external hard drive. Otherwise I can go ahead and choose to recover these 88 files to a specific folder, like I said. And again keeping in mind, you can add files as needed, here you can even change your view to the thumbnail view or the list view. You get all of the data. You can even search manually if you know a specific file that you-re looking for. Otherwise you hit Recover in the top right and just like that, it was that easy to recover all my files. You can see a success message here. I can go ahead and click on the show status here. And you can see this is where it exported the photo. Just like that I was able to recover the files that easy and that simple with Disk Drill. Again, It doesn-t get any easier than that. Simply plugin your iOS device, have it backup if it hasn-t run a backup already, or restore from previous backups know that anytime you need your data recovered it-s that simple and easy with Disk Drill
